How Does Laser Hair Removal Work?

Laser hair removal uses concentrated light to target and destroy hair follicles, leading to permanent reduction in hair growth. Multiple sessions are required (typically 6 to 8) as the laser can only treat hairs in the active growth phase. Modern diode lasers like Soprano Ice are effective on all skin tones.

What Affects Laser Hair Removal Prices in Bali?

The main factors are the treatment area size (small areas like upper lip are cheapest, full body packages cost more), the device used, and whether you book individual sessions or a package. Packages typically offer 30 to 50% savings versus individual sessions.

Most people require 6 to 8 sessions for significant permanent reduction. Sessions are spaced 4 to 8 weeks apart to target hair in different growth phases. Some areas like the face may need additional sessions.

Modern lasers like Soprano Ice and Nd:YAG are safe and effective on all skin tones, including darker complexions. Older IPL devices are less suitable for darker skin. Always confirm which device the clinic uses and whether it is appropriate for your skin type.

Most modern diode lasers (like Soprano Ice) use cooling technology that makes treatment very comfortable. Older devices can be more painful. Sensitive areas like the bikini line and underarms tend to be the most uncomfortable. Most patients describe it as a warm snapping sensation.

You can start a treatment course in Bali, but a single session will not produce permanent results. If you visit Bali regularly, you could schedule sessions during each trip. Some patients do 2 to 3 sessions during an extended stay, then continue at home.

The most popular areas are underarms, bikini line, full legs, and upper lip. Full body packages (covering all major areas) are popular with patients who want comprehensive hair reduction. Many clinics offer discounted packages for multiple areas.

Shave the treatment area 24 hours before your session (do not wax or pluck). Avoid sun exposure and self-tanner for 2 weeks before treatment. Discontinue retinol products for 1 week beforehand. Arrive with clean skin, free of lotions or deodorant on the treatment area.

Laser hair removal provides permanent hair reduction, not complete permanent removal. After a full course, most patients see 70 to 90% reduction in hair growth. Some fine or light hairs may persist. Annual maintenance sessions can address any regrowth.

Soprano Ice (Alma Lasers) and Clarity II (Lutronic) are considered among the best devices available. Both offer fast treatment times, built-in cooling, and effectiveness across all skin tones. Ask your clinic which device they use.

Laser hair removal in Bali costs 70 to 85% less than Australia. An underarm session costing AUD $80 to $150 in Australia costs AUD $15 to $40 in Bali. Full body packages in Bali cost roughly the same as treating one area in Australia.
